Consultation on USS – deadline approaching


May 8th, 2015

The employer consultation on proposed changes to USS is ongoing, and will remain open until 22 May 2015.

You can read information about the changes, watch a video, use an interactive modeller to estimate the impact of the changes on your own pension arrangements and leave a response on the consultation website.

We want to hear your views; the feedback you give does matter, you may wish to simply give us your opinion or offer variations to the proposed changes – all feedback is welcomed and will be considered. Once all responses have been reviewed, the trustee will decide whether it is appropriate to make any recommendations to modify the current proposal.

The online response form consists of twelve questions. However, you do not need to leave answers to all questions in order for your response to be valid. You may wish to leave a response for only one, or a selection of, the questions. However, you do need to press ‘submit’ for your response to be recorded so if you’ve started a response please be sure to go back and submit it so your views are taken into account.
